LASIK - Laser Eye Surgery

How does LASIK work? ; With LASIK, a surgeon cuts a sliver of tissue, essentially creating a flap at the front of the eye to expose the inner layers of corneal tissue to an excimer laser. Surgeons will either use a mechanical instrument called a microkeratome, or a femtosecond laser to create the flap. When a femtosecond laser is used to create the LASIK flap, the procedure is described as Femto-LASIK surgery. This type of laser is extremely short-pulsed and near infrared.
